An incomplete (about 85% of the coin survives) silver denarius of Elagabulus dating to the period AD 218-222 (Reece Period 10). LIBERALITAS AV[G __]II (possibly III or IIII at end of reverse legend). Reverse depicts Liberalitas draped, holding abacus and cornucopiae. Mint of Rome. Obverse shows a laureate, draped bust right. Obverse legend: [IM]P ANTONINVS PIVS AVG. See RIC IV, part 2, page 35, nos 98-104. Diameter: 19.57mm. Thickness: 1.47mm. Weight: 1.8g. Die axis: 12 o'clock.

A silver denarius of Elagabalus, dating to the period AD 218-222 (Reece 10). FIDES MILITVM reverse depicting Fides standing, head turned right, holding standard and vexillum. Mint of Rome. RIC IV (II), p. 33, no. 73. Dimensions: 19.9mm diameter, 2mm thick. Weight: 2.44g.

A complete, Roman, struck or hammered, debased silver alloy, Denarius of Elagabalus (218-222AD). Obverse: Draped, laureate bust right Inscription: illegible. Reverse: Elagabalus in priestly robes, standing left, sacrificing out of a pateria over a possible tripod altar, star in field. Inscription: illegible. Die axis: 6 o'clock. Reece Period 10. The coin is in fair condition, very worn but corroded with an irregular 'nibbled' edge. there are a number of small patches of green verdigris coming through on both sides otherwise a silvery coloured surface.
